Transaction 95ef6f167726bc89566eea112b0619cca9e09f10fa3c166bfe98dd11a338231b
1 Input
1 Output
-
95ef6f167726bc89566eea112b0619cca9e09f10fa3c166bfe98dd11a338231b:0
- value
- 8755819
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e56a6888212413c68048a3aed75f36b4a3ccddc
- address
- bc1qdet2dzyzzfqnc6qy3gaw6a0ndd9renwur05wpj